I made this Persian lute using a locally grown gourd. It is fretless with nylon strings and the nut and bridge were carved from bone purchased at the local pet store. I used a wood burning pen to burn the decorative vines on the top. The pegs are wooden dowels sanded down to fit the peg holes.
